destilla gmbh is germany Buyer&Supplier,
and primarily engages in the import and export business of products such as cocoa shell,cocoa husk,cocoa skin.
According to the 52wmb.com global trade database, as of 2025-08-26, the company has completed 941 international trades,
with its main trading regions covering colombia,brazil,indonesia etc.
The core products include HS1802000000,HS09030090,HS12129910 etc,
often transported via hamburg,port frankfurt am main, port hong kong etc,
and its main trading partners are sucesores de jose jesus restrepo y cia s.a.casa luker s.a.,mate brasil industria exportacao & comercio eireli,konimex.
